package org.eclipse.jdt.internal.codeassist.complete;
import org.eclipse.jdt.internal.compiler.ast.MessageSend;
import org.eclipse.jdt.internal.compiler.impl.Constant;
import org.eclipse.jdt.internal.compiler.lookup.BlockScope;
import org.eclipse.jdt.internal.compiler.lookup.TypeBinding;
public class CompletionOnMessageSendName extends MessageSend {
public CompletionOnMessageSendName(char[] selector, int start, int end) {
super();
this.selector = selector;
this.sourceStart = start;
this.sourceEnd = end;
this.nameSourcePosition = end;
}
@Override
public TypeBinding resolveType(BlockScope scope) {
this.constant = Constant.NotAConstant;
if (this.receiver.isImplicitThis())
throw new CompletionNodeFound();
this.actualReceiverType = this.receiver.resolveType(scope);
if (this.actualReceiverType == null || this.actualReceiverType.isBaseType() || this.actualReceiverType.isArrayType())
throw new CompletionNodeFound();
if (this.typeArguments != null) {
int length = this.typeArguments.length;
this.genericTypeArguments = new TypeBinding[length];
for (int i = 0; i < length; i++) {
this.genericTypeArguments[i] = this.typeArguments[i].resolveType(scope, true );
}
}
throw new CompletionNodeFound(this, this.actualReceiverType, scope);
}
@Override
public StringBuffer printExpression(int indent, StringBuffer output) {
output.append("<CompleteOnMessageSendName:");
if (!this.receiver.isImplicitThis()) this.receiver.printExpression(0, output).append('.');
if (this.typeArguments != null) {
output.append('<');
int max = this.typeArguments.length - 1;
for (int j = 0; j < max; j++) {
this.typeArguments[j].print(0, output);
output.append(", ");
}
this.typeArguments[max].print(0, output);
output.append('>');
}
output.append(this.selector).append('(');
return output.append(")>");
}
}
